Output d8513a2617ef822513d429a08669a8cda2d8f519c0af9645ea7edc87ba0f7d5d:22

value
11608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a88dd2c3cadb31ec18379f79735b014e3c18424 OP_EQUAL
address
38V7tDLo7tavr92GGpLBuszH11xZaKt8Ka
transaction
d8513a2617ef822513d429a08669a8cda2d8f519c0af9645ea7edc87ba0f7d5d